1. "Gypsy"
If you're looking for a thriller with a dramatic flair and characters who you'll either probably hate or will probably love, this is the total package. "Gypsy" is a tense drama filled with twists and turns that go on within its first season. The protagonist; a character played by the wonderful Naomi Watts, who is a therapist. She's a great one, although she is a person who seems a bit too interested in her patients. The performances feel so real and have you shaking the entire time.
2. "Master Of None"
Dating is fun, right? Well, sometimes it can be. This series starring comedian Aziz Ansari, depicts the life of a normal nerdy guy who can't seem to find the right one. It follows his attempts to get a woman who fits his needs. It's a rollercoaster ride of helpful dating advice for our generation.

4. "The Ranch"
This raunchy sitcom involving the great Ashton Kutcher has many nostalgic similarities to "That's 70's Show." The jokes that are given throughout the show are so well delivered that they will seriously keep you laughing for hours. In some odd way, it's actually kind of relatable too.

6. "House of Cards"
This phenomenal, groundbreaking creation of a Netflix original is lead by Kevin Spacey, -- a genius of an actor may I say. I call him a genius because the way he carries on the five seasons (so far) and builds his character's charisma with the other lead and supporting characters is remarkable. This politically driven plate of drama includes love and a dark, twisted touch to it. Not much of a thriller but more of showing the deep dark angle of politics that the public doesn't see.
7. Marvel's "Daredevil"
This was the first of Marvel's series on Netflix. First released in 2015, it now has two seasons under its belt. Charlie Cox plays an intimidating portrayal of Daredevil, showing all of the violent human beings that live deep in Hell's Kitchen.
